And then Blaster has to go ruin all the fun by breaking the (unconstitutional) Stolen Valor Act of 2005 — if he’s telling the truth and not just being an epic troll.

The Supreme Court in October announced it would soon be taking up the constitutionality of the Stolen Valor Act, which made it a crime to lie about having received military medals.
